Transaction 180c24458cf8c351fa917986ed36842072c2459ee07eb63a03849c10b783f90c

1 Input
2 Outputs
  • 180c24458cf8c351fa917986ed36842072c2459ee07eb63a03849c10b783f90c:0
  • value  266209
    address  3DSKFGgVVo4mn3QftpdUSyU2E24tyBVaaa
  • 180c24458cf8c351fa917986ed36842072c2459ee07eb63a03849c10b783f90c:1
  • value  3045008
    address  16d1e6fr46oCop5rMNWUFt8iC3TgW4tM5w